Ammunition, 500kg charas seized


RAWALPINDI, July 25: The Anti-Narcotics Force recovered 504kg charas and a huge quantity of ammunition during two separate crackdowns in Rawalpindi and Attock, the authorities said on Tuesday.

They said a raiding party recovered 504kg charas concealed in 393 leather jackets and arrested two persons. The consignment was stored at a petrol pump near the motorway chowk, GT road, Rawalpindi.

The arrested persons were identified as Sardar Khan, a resident of Peshawar, and Hameedullah of Swat.

In another crackdown in Attock, the ANF’s raiding party signalled a car (LZS-2765) coming from Peshawar to stop. But the driver sped away.

The ANF staff chased the car in two vehicles and finally forced him to stop near Kalu Dab and arrested three persons. The ANF recovered three Kalashnikovs, one 222-bore rifle, one revolver, seven magazines, two butts, one spring and 440 rounds of different bores from the vehicle.—Staff Reporter
